Why Choose Vinyl Flooring



Within the numerous flooring alternatives, vinyl flooring stands out as a pets friendly flooring choice.
It provides outstanding durability and is renowned for its low maintenance.
Here are some notable features of vinyl flooring:


  • Resistant to scratches, suitable for scratches

  • Waterproof, managing spills efficiently

  • Comfortable underfoot, great for both owners and pets

  • Offers a wide range of patterns to match any decor

  • Affordable, with options for flooring discount


Choosing vinyl flooring serves as a prudent decision for animal lovers.

Understanding Engineered Hardwood Flooring



Engineered hardwood flooring is another excellent option for pet-friendly flooring.
It merges the charm of real wood with improved stability.
This type of flooring is engineered to withstand daily use whilst keeping its look.
It reduces dents and moisture, making it suitable for busy households.
Moreover, it contributes appeal to your home.
Choosing engineered hardwood flooring offers a durable choice for pet owners.

Methods to Estimate Cost of Flooring sq ft



Correctly estimating the cost of flooring per square foot is essential for managing expenses.
Begin by, determining the area you intend to floor.
Then, look up the cost of your chosen flooring material, whether it's vinyl flooring or engineered hardwood flooring.
Add extra expenses such as installation, subfloor preparation, and moldings.
Calculate the overall price by the amount of square feet to determine the price per square foot.
This method helps you to compare multiple materials effectively.
Accurate calculation makes sure you stay within your financial limits.
